The historic market town of Morpeth, 8 miles away, is home to quaint, cobbled streets lined with a wonderful range of shops and places to eat, as well as quirky farmers’ markets. Spanning a 7-mile stretch of stunning coastline, Druridge Bay, 5.5 miles away, offers a sanctuary for scenic walks, birdwatching and anyone looking to soak up some fresh sea air. The waterfront town of Amble (9 miles) at the mouth of the River Coquet is perfectly placed for exploring the whole of the Northumberland Coast National Landscape.
